CAS 89543-23-7
:2-Butenoic acid, 2-chloro-4-(cyclopropylamino)-4-oxo-, (E)-
Description:
2-Butenoic acid, 2-chloro-4-(cyclopropylamino)-4-oxo-, (E)-, with the CAS number 89543-23-7, is a chemical compound characterized by its unique structural features. It contains a butenoic acid moiety, indicating the presence of a double bond and a carboxylic acid functional group. The compound also features a chloro substituent and a cyclopropylamino group, which contribute to its reactivity and potential biological activity. The (E)- configuration denotes that the highest priority substituents on the double bond are on opposite sides, influencing its stereochemistry and potentially its interactions in biological systems. This compound may exhibit properties typical of both carboxylic acids and amines, such as acidity and the ability to form hydrogen bonds. Its unique structure suggests potential applications in pharmaceuticals or agrochemicals, although specific uses would depend on further research into its biological activity and chemical behavior. Overall, the compound's characteristics make it of interest in various fields of chemistry and medicinal research.
Formula:C7H8ClNO3
